#6b00de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b00de is composed of 42% red, 0%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.8%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 268.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 43.5%. #6b00de color hex could be obtained by blending #d600ff with #0000bd.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#6b00de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6b00de has RGB values of R:107, G:0,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:1,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 7012574.

Shades and Tints of #6b00de
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030006 is the darkest color, while #f8f2ff is the lightest one.
